Granite City is joining in the Oktoberfest celebrations and will be having a tapping party September 28th.
First, we’ll tap Oktoberfest, Granite City’s most popular seasonal beer, known for its orange/amber color, medium body and flavors of sweet maltiness and toasted biscuit, with subtle hints of caramel. Then it’s time for a veritable feast of complimentary bratwursts, saurkraut, coleslaw, chips and Broad Axe Stout beans.
And as a bonus, we’re keeping our Oktoberfest brew tapped through January 2010.
